Monitoring suspicious activity within the real-estate market

Monitoring suspicious activities within the real estate market as a special agent in real estate requires a keen eye for detail and a thorough understanding of the industry. As a special agent, it is crucial to identify and investigate any irregularities or red flags that may indicate fraudulent behavior.

Conducting thorough background checks of individuals involved in real-estate transactions is a key aspect to monitoring suspicious activity. This includes verifiying the identities of individuals, checking criminal history, and investigating previous involvement in fraudulent scheme.

Special agents should also keep an eye on financial transactions occurring in the real estate industry. This includes tracking wire transfers and monitoring large transactions. It also includes looking for unusual patterns which may indicate laundering of money.

Another important aspect of monitoring suspicious activities is working closely with law enforcement and other regulatory agencies to share information and coordinate investigations. It is essential to collaborate with other agencies to collect evidence and build cases against individuals involved in fraudulent practices.

Special agents must also remain informed regarding current trend and developments within the real estate sector. This includes being aware of new schemes, and of methods that criminals use to take advantage of the industry in order to gain financial gain.

In conclusion, monitoring suspicious activities within the real estate market as a special agent in real estate requires diligence, attention to detail, and collaboration with other agencies. By being alert while being pro-active, agents can help defend consumers and maintain integrity in the real estate industry.

Analyzing data to detect patterns in criminal behavior

Special Agent Real Estates are also known as Real Estate Intelligence Officers. They play an important role in the analysis of data to detect patterns and criminal behavior in the real estate industry. They are responsible for identifying real estate transactions which may be linked to criminal activities like money laundering, fraud or organized crime.

One of the primary tasks of a special agent real estate is to collect and analyze data from various sources such as property records, financial documents, and real estate listings. By examining this data, they can identify suspicious patterns or anomalies that may indicate criminal activity.

Special Agent Real Estate can also use advanced analytical software and tools to identify trends and correlations within the data. Data visualization techniques may be used to show the connections between various individuals or properties suspected in criminal activity.

Special Agent Real Estate, in addition to analyzing data and sharing information with other law enforcement organizations and agencies, also collaborates to coordinate investigations and share information. This can involve working closely with financial institutions, regulatory agencies, and other government departments to gather intelligence and build cases against suspected criminals.

Special Agent Real Estates disrupt illegal activities by detecting patterns in criminal behavior within the real estate sector. They also protect the integrity and safety of the market. Their work helps to ensure real estate transactions are conducted legally and ethically and that criminals can be held accountable.
